Thirteen-year-old Bella tries to keep the tradition of lectors going in her Cuban-American community when workers clash with the owners of the cigar factory putting the jobs of lectors in jeopardy.
A Pulitzer Prize-winning play by Nilo Cruz set in 1929 Florida in a Cuban-American cigar factory, where a new lector unwittingly becomes a catalyst in the lives of his avid listeners.
